Shift toward eco-friendly PVD coatings replacing traditional electroplating in manufacturing processes
Manufacturers are increasingly reassessing surface finishing processes as environmental compliance, workplace safety, and wastewater management become more important in production planning, creating a clear opening for the physical vapor deposition faucet finishes market. Compared with traditional electroplating, PVD coating aligns better with cleaner manufacturing strategies and helps faucet producers reduce exposure to process-related environmental constraints that can complicate operations and raise treatment costs. This influences sourcing and capital investment decisions at the factory level, as companies upgrading finishing lines or repositioning product portfolios toward more sustainable claims are more likely to expand their use of PVD-based finishes.

Home Use held the leading position in the physical vapor deposition faucet finishes market in 2025, accounting for a 59.75% share. This leadership is maintained through the steady volume of residential bathroom and kitchen upgrades, where buyers prioritize finishes that combine appearance retention with resistance to daily wear. In the physical vapor deposition faucet finishes market, Home Use benefits from broad replacement demand and the practical appeal of long-lasting surface performance in owner-occupied housing, which keeps this application segment firmly ahead.
Hotel Use is emerging as the fastest-growing application in the physical vapor deposition faucet finishes market as hospitality operators place greater emphasis on durable fixtures that can withstand frequent use while maintaining a premium visual standard. Growth is being aided by renovation activity and new hotel projects where finish longevity directly affects maintenance cycles and guest-facing presentation. Compared with residential demand, Hotel Use is gaining momentum because commercial operators have stronger operational incentives to adopt surface finishes that reduce visible deterioration in high-traffic environments.
